Silicon Design Engineer - Ser Des Validation
Join AMD’s High‑Speed Ser Des Validation team to ensure our cutting‑edge I/O technologies meet industry standards and deliver exceptional performance. This role focuses on post‑silicon validation, characterization, and optimization of high‑speed interfaces across multiple product generations. You will work on advanced Ser Des architectures and collaborate with global teams to validate and tune designs for optimal performance.
The PersonAs a member of the Ser Des Validation team, you are passionate about high‑speed signaling technologies and thrive in a fast‑paced environment. You have strong analytical and problem‑solving skills, can debug complex silicon issues, and develop innovative validation methodologies. You communicate effectively, collaborate across sites, and are self‑driven to achieve technical excellence.
Key Responsibilities- Post‑Silicon Validation of high‑speed Ser Des.
- Understand the industry requirements and specifications for high‑speed IO.
- Develop validation methodology to validate new industry standards and requirements.
- Characterize the latest Ser Des design.
- Debug Ser Des with designers on Silicon.
- Tune the latest design to optimal performance settings.
- Generate specifications based on measured results.
- Work with remote teams to coordinate distributed tasks.
- Support FAE on customer issues relating to high‑speed IOs.
- Experience in high‑speed IO Ser Des post‑silicon validation.
- In‑depth knowledge of the latest industry standards such as PCIe, Display Port, JESD, SDI, OIF-CEI-11G/25G/56G/112G‑VSR/SR/MR/LR, IEEE 802.3 KR/CR/CAUI/GAUI, etc.
- Strong programming/scripting skills in languages such as Python, C/C++, TCL for firmware development, test methodology development, and test automation.
- Extensive experience with common lab equipment, including BERT, analyzers, oscilloscopes, PNA/VNA, etc.
- Knowledge of Ser Des general architectures and link‑level system analysis.
- Experience in system‑level serial link analysis and simulation, system performance optimization, and standard/architecture level study using tools such as MATLAB, ADS, etc.
- Bachelors or Masters degree in Computer Engineering/Electrical Engineering.
